Very Newbie Question so please be gentle:
I want to put my library of edited lightroom photos on my wifes computer so I'm exporting them all. But the problem is that my exported jpgs are much larger in file size than the original and I don't understand why. (My folder of originals will take 1.2GB of space but my exported folder is 2.9GB)
I have played with various export settings in order to keep the file sizes similar but the settings I end up with is 8'% quality and 18'' length of longest size. And that's really not what I'm after.
So what am I doing wrong? I know HDD space is cheap nowadays but if there's a trick or formula I should be following to get similar size/quality as the original then I figure I should learn it now because all those extra gigs will add up quick.
